ASTM International’s thermal measurements committee ( E37 ) is developing a proposed standard that describes a reliable technique for investigating the thermal transport properties of materials. The proposed standard ( WK49591 ) will help to provide information on thermal conductivity, thermal diffusivity, and volumetric heat capacity. ASTM International announced today the Journal of Testing and Evaluation, the organization’s flagship journal, received an increased 2020 impact factor rating of 1.264, up nearly 45% from the previous year. The impact factor is calculated each year by Clarivate Analytics and given to journals that appear in their database, Science Citation Index. A new ASTM International standard will help gasket manufacturers test to see how their products handle various compressions and loads. The test method shows the compression properties of a gasket by measuring its deflection while subjected to an increasing load. A new ASTM International standard helps ensure quality of a new fire-fighting agent known as 2-BTP, which could be used in fire extinguishers on airplanes and elsewhere. The new standard ( D8060 , Specification for 2-Bromo-3,3,3-Trifluoro-1-Propene (CF3CBr=CH2) was developed by ASTM’s committee on halogenated organic solvents and fire extinguishing agents ( D26 ). Rotational viscometry is an easily used tool for determining the viscosity of fluids, including paints, petroleum products and polymer solutions. While standards often make use of rotational viscometry, a procedure for calibrating or validating the measurement is not always part of the standard, which could lead to results that differ from one laboratory to another.
